Hello again – 9(2)(h)
I’ve discussed with Conor and we have shortened the draft response: 
We received complaints from Police and from members of the public about strikers’ actions on the road at two 
RELEASED 
pickets.  The complaints were about dangerous behaviour in traffic.  
We monitored CTV cameras at the two places in question during the one-hour strike. On all occasions there was a 
Police presence in the room, and we observed no concerns.

Hi Megan 
I agree with Jackie’s statement below 
There were two locations that we observed which were  
1. Cavendish drive and Lambie Drive Counties Manukau
2. Pitt street and K Road
Because we had received complaints from the public or through Police about the behaviour of our 
firefighters and dangerous interactions between them and cars 
On all occasions there were no concerns that we observed 
On the day of the Silverdale incident we did try and look at Silverdale but there were no cameras 
available 
On one of the occasions we did also look at Northcross when there was intel that there was going 
to be a larger contingent gathering after the Silverdale incident 
All occasions including ATOC I have had Police in the room 
All the cameras were in Public spaces 
The cameras have been very valuable when incidents have occurred 
Other than the 2nd January the cameras have been operated by AEM
